Chapel Hill Gold Hardy Lantana

lantana

It is a perennial, flowering shrub, see how the Chapel hill gold hardy lantana looks like in the garden and landscape.

Chapel Hill Gold Hardy Lantana is suitable for growing in USDA hardiness zones: 7b, 8a, 8b, 9a, 9b, 10a, 10b, 11a, 11b. Other winter zone scales for planting this lantana are ANBG: 1, 2, 3, 4, 5; RHS: H5, H4, H3, H2, H1c; PHZ: 8b, 9a.

Lantana details

Plant typeshrub, berry, flowering, border
Life cycleperennial
Sun needsfull sun, part sun
Growth habitupright, spreading
Flowering periodspring, summer, fall
Height at maturity30 sm - 45 sm
Spread90 sm
Spacing60 sm - 80 sm for mass plantings; 6' (1.8m) for space between plants
Soil typeloamy, sandy, clay, silty
Soil moist/drainagewell drained moist, dry
Soil PH5.5 - 6.5 (moderately acidic - neutral)
Water needsvery low when established
Maintenance / carevery low
Resistance todeer, disease, drought, heat, insect, humidity, rabbit, dry soil
Gardens typesxeriscape, rock
